Ashaka Cement Plant

Cement Plant in Nigeria. Approximate location 10.931, 11.47583.

Cement PlantNigeriaCO₂ reported

Ashaka Cement Plant is a cement plant in Nigeria with a reported capacity of 1,000,000 t of cement. It burns limestone in high-temperature rotary kilns to make clinker and cement. It is operated by Lafarge Africa PLC. By capacity it ranks #10 of 10 cement plants tracked in Nigeria. It emits about 404,790 tonnes of CO₂e per year (Climate TRACE) — roughly the tailpipe emissions of 94,357 cars. Its CO₂ per unit of capacity is about 12% above the median cement plant.

Local climate

Ashaka Cement Plant sits in a hot semi-arid steppe climate zone (Köppen BSh), at 10.9°N in the northern hemisphere.

~23°Ctypical annual mean
~31°Ctypical warm-season
Hot semi-arid steppe: warm all year, with distinct wet and dry seasons
